Outline of Annual Research Achievements

I have finished my JSPS fellow and am grateful that JSPS gave me such a good opportunity with funding to support my research. I have achieved several important milestones regarding my research. First, I have recorded eye movements from head-restrained marmosets while they were viewing fearful and non-fearful pictures. It was clear that they spent more time looking at the fearful pictures. I have also successfully tested several different 3D printed implants on the marmosets. Furthermore, I have trained the marmosets with saccade tasks and I am currently writing a manuscript on the results. As a side product, I have also successfully performed microstimulation in marmoset cortex and identified an important brain area related to saccade. I have finished the data acquisition and will start to write the manuscript soon. I also successfully established method for brain microinjection on marmosets and successfully traced the superior colliculus. This is very important result. As what stated last year, I have also performed double injection, one anterograde in the superior colliculus and one retrograde in the amygdala in the same marmoset to exploring the connection between the two brain areas. I am currently testing several types of AAV virus to have good expression for future optogenetic experiments. With the grant provided by JSPS, I have also participated several local and international conferences to present my work and got feedbacks from other researchers. Overall, I believe I have reached several goals I set before and I would like to continue my research about innate fear.
